Planning the Electrical Layout and Safe Power Transfer
A successful installation starts with assessing your main service panel, transfer method, and the circuits you want supported. The electrician will evaluate load requirements so the generator can handle starting surges from appliances and motors. That evaluation is crucial because compressors, well pumps, and HVAC blowers can draw more power at recessed lighting installation startup than they do during steady operation. By sizing the system and selecting the right transfer components, the project can deliver stable power with fewer interruptions. You also benefit from a cleaner, code-compliant approach that integrates backup power without compromising existing wiring.
During planning, discuss how the system will distribute electricity across your home. Many homeowners choose a set of priority circuits such as refrigerators, security systems, internet equipment, and select outlets. This can be especially useful for hallways, kitchens, and entryways where quick visibility matters when the grid goes down. The goal is to create a practical “keep running” map so your home remains functional, not just partially powered.
Site Setup, Permits, and Ongoing Reliability Checks
Generator placement influences performance, safety, and long-term maintenance access. The electrician typically considers ventilation, clearance requirements, noise concerns, and how the generator connects to fuel and electrical pathways. A thoughtful location helps ensure the unit operates efficiently and remains serviceable when technicians need to inspect parts or connections. In many cases, proper installation also includes coordinating paperwork for permits and verifying compliance with applicable electrical codes. This protects your investment and helps ensure the system is integrated safely with your home’s electrical infrastructure.
Once the equipment is installed, commissioning and testing help confirm the system behaves as expected. The contractor should test transfer operation and verify that designated circuits energize correctly during simulated outages. Homeowners should also receive clear guidance on safe operation, including what to do during an outage and how to interpret any indicator lights or alerts. Regular maintenance—such as filter and oil checks for the unit and inspection of connections—helps prevent performance drift over time. When the system is maintained and checked, you can count on smoother transitions and fewer surprises during real outages.
